Output f83ec50089b6d0aab5eec77e899879e2f272a853784a564757104b309c1fde8b:1

value
12805060
script pubkey
OP_0 OP_PUSHBYTES_20 3180a1338a4332dfaf30184324f4ccaae1cb5137
address
bc1qxxq2zvu2gvedltesrppjfaxv4tsuk5fhqwweh2
transaction
f83ec50089b6d0aab5eec77e899879e2f272a853784a564757104b309c1fde8b
confirmations
103523
spent
true